Pride Prepares for First-Ever Parade On Sunday

For the first time in Muskoka Pride’s ten years, there will be a parade as part of the festivities.

Pride Organizer Shawn Forth says the reason there have not been previous parades was the perceived red tape for getting such an event off the ground.

“We thought for the 10th anniversary, let’s do it,” Forth said.

He said the logistics have been considerable, but the important ingredient is the volunteers.

“We are lucky to have a lot of volunteers that are excited,” he said.

The participation from the corporate community has been very exciting he added.

Forth says the more intimate size of the Muskoka Pride celebration has been what helps make the event stand out against more visible events such as the Toronto and Montreal pride parades.

Muskoka Pride will cap off its celebration in Bracebridge on Sunday at 11:30 am with the Parade starting on Manitoba Street. Immediately following, is the Pride Picnic from 12:00 pm to 4:00 pm at Memorial Park, featuring vendors, entertainment, and free food.
